优秀 发表于 2014-11-13 09:22

【s1都是开发者】巨硬这几步算正道还是邪道?

本帖最后由 优秀 于 2014-11-13 09:25 编辑

这两天的新闻,纳德拉上任几把火还没烧完,和泡沫显然不是一条道上的:

1、.net 要开源,支持mac和linux,这个看不懂是好是坏
2、vs2013社区版免费,这个绝对好事
3、vs2015预览版。。。一年一个版本?太快了吧,刷版本号有啥意思

主要是第一个,我没用.net,不知道它现在的影响力以及开源后会变成怎么样,会死还是会活还是半死不活(我私下揣摩它现在就是半死不活),看看大家有什么看法。
另外,三哥ceo这些新政不知能持续多久,现在总是个好现象,就怕半年一年后又走回以前老路

nonmoi 发表于 2014-11-13 09:31

1、是泡馍三年前拍板放行的,否则你以为?
2、免费升级其实不是关键(以前也有express版本是免费的),关键是vs对跨平台开发的支持和新出的微软官方安卓模拟器插件。
3、vs和.net同时期出新版有什么问题?而且vs版本更新差不多就是一两年一次,并没有更快。

oz01 发表于 2014-11-13 09:38

同nonmoi
微软这次简直是要创造信仰
简直棒极了

优秀 发表于 2014-11-13 09:55

nonmoi 发表于 2014-11-13 09:31
1、是泡馍三年前拍板放行的,否则你以为?
2、免费升级其实不是关键(以前也有express版本是免费的),关键 ...

第一个原来是泡沫拍板的,这个真不知道。
版本号那个纯粹是周围的人都说vs2013还没用上就出2015了

大侠能说说dotnet现在的影响力不?

oz01 发表于 2014-11-13 10:11

优秀 发表于 2014-11-13 09:55
第一个原来是泡沫拍板的,这个真不知道。
版本号那个纯粹是周围的人都说vs2013还没用上就出2015了



你用一下就知道了
这玩意超级方便的

西门无恨 发表于 2014-11-13 10:33

風美由飛 发表于 2014-11-13 10:44

不是在弄2014嘛。反正刷版本号是爆沫这傻逼干的好事啦,2013都分8.0专用和8.1专用,win10不刷死你还好意思咩。当然这马屁精阿三也不会是啥好鸟。下个C#又是加了一堆东西,码农就学到老死吧233
    —— from S1 Nyan (NOKIA Lumia 526)

nonmoi 发表于 2014-11-13 10:54

風美由飛 发表于 2014-11-13 10:44
不是在弄2014嘛。反正刷版本号是爆沫这傻逼干的好事啦,2013都分8.0专用和8.1专用,win10不刷死你还好意思 ...

VS4.0 - 1995
VS97(5.0) - 1997
VS6.0 - 1998
VS.NET (7.0)-2002
VS.NET 2003 (7.1) -2003
VS 2005 (8.0) - 2005
VS 2008 (9.0)- 2007
VS 2010 (10.0)- 2010
VS 2012 (11.0)- 2012
VS 2013 (12.0)- 2013

nonmoi 发表于 2014-11-13 10:55

优秀 发表于 2014-11-13 09:55
第一个原来是泡沫拍板的,这个真不知道。
版本号那个纯粹是周围的人都说vs2013还没用上就出2015了



我记得论坛里有专门做.net开发的,我作为不懂技术的斗胆抛砖引玉一下,希望懂行的能做更详细的科普:

我的理解是.net不是一种语言,它的影响力主要取决于它本身有多优秀,以及支持什么操作系统平台。前一点应该是毋庸置疑的,我听到的观点在这个方面比较一致——如果微软从一开始就对.net开源,而不是锁闭在Windows系内部,Java就根本不会兴起。

vdo 发表于 2014-11-13 11:03

java都快成工业标准了,微软自己作死

newdasemo 发表于 2014-11-13 11:05

風美由飛 发表于 2014-11-13 11:09

java要死还是等甲骨文的2000万paper变成2亿吧。
    —— from S1 Nyan (NOKIA Lumia 526)

nonmoi 发表于 2014-11-13 11:24

newdasemo 发表于 2014-11-13 11:05
目前无论产品还是路线,阿三都完全没有改变,全是泡沫的东西。
    —— from S1 Nyan (HTC 8X) ...

WP方面不太清楚……XBone的话,取消Kinect捆绑应该是新一代领导层的决策,毕竟这是微软寄予大量希望的泰坦销售失败之后的事情……

nonmoi 发表于 2014-11-13 11:27

風美由飛 发表于 2014-11-13 11:09
java要死还是等甲骨文的2000万paper变成2亿吧。
    —— from S1 Nyan (NOKIA Lumia 526) ...

这个我觉得还是要看甲骨文战谷歌最后什么结果,当然要是真的被甲骨文这混账逆转……影响绝不只是一个语言的问题了。

西门无恨 发表于 2014-11-13 11:37

优秀 发表于 2014-11-13 11:39

谷歌当年选java做android开发语言时肯定没想到以后会被甲骨文爆菊花,不知道现在后悔没。

说回巨硬,大家都觉得dotnet开源还是有戏的?至少比现在强

iou90 发表于 2014-11-13 11:41

nonmoi 发表于 2014-11-13 09:31
1、是泡馍三年前拍板放行的,否则你以为?
2、免费升级其实不是关键(以前也有express版本是免费的),关键 ...

2 以前的各种express真是受够了 话说望京这边vs的销售都不屑于鸟个人开发者的 只会高傲的说怎么好卖怎么卖怎么有233

现在都不一样了

vdo 发表于 2014-11-13 11:47

如果.net全平台都可以编译成bin摆脱.net框架那就完美了

nonmoi 发表于 2014-11-13 11:52

iou90 发表于 2014-11-13 11:41
2 以前的各种express真是受够了 话说望京这边vs的销售都不屑于鸟个人开发者的 只会高傲的说怎么好卖怎么 ...

嗯,微软对个人和小型开发商不友善是出名的,这一步的确是走得不错。

jun4rui 发表于 2014-11-13 12:05

鸡蛋灌饼 发表于 2014-11-13 12:06

本帖最后由 鸡蛋灌饼 于 2014-11-13 12:11 编辑

优秀 发表于 2014-11-13 11:39
谷歌当年选java做android开发语言时肯定没想到以后会被甲骨文爆菊花,不知道现在后悔没。

说回巨硬,大家 ...
会比现在强是不假,但APK现在都快被折腾成非苹果系触摸设备的de facto Standard了,已经扳不回来了。

另外当年Java还在SUN手下,没Oracle的事。

jun4rui 发表于 2014-11-13 12:10

nonmoi 发表于 2014-11-13 12:12

西门无恨 发表于 2014-11-13 11:37
错了,微软搞.net的时候,java已经在事实上占据企业开发的有利位置了

但是微软如果可以早一点开源(其实 ...

虽然的确是这样,但是.net有多语言支持等特性,如果当年就能泛平台,竞争力应该还是有的。
当时不泛平台的主要原因我觉得还是它们想要在服务器市场上做到垄断地位——这个最后失败了,自然对应的.net的政策也变成了一个笑话。

开源其实主要还是要把Xamarin绑上战车,现在这样,自然就不会出现Google和Compaq的逆向工程绕开专利授权了。所以开源和泛平台本身就是相辅相成的,甚至可以说是互成充要的,微软作为当年和Compaq几为同谋的合作伙伴(给Compaq最原始版本的IBM DOS,并在之后从康柏逆向授权购买了完美支持EISA的DOS版本)相信从IBM当年的失败中还是学到了不少的。

另一方面,的确如你所说,当时的微软的确没有勇气和动力开创新的纪元,不但移动设备派(WinCE派)被清洗,就是提出服务导向,受到泡馍全面支持的首席构架巫师也只能黯然离去——不对Windows又红又专,就要滚蛋。
这几年微软被一波带来,一波带走,也算是自食其果。

zatsuza 发表于 2014-11-13 12:15

.NET没起来纯粹巨硬自己作死,在自家平台上都问题重重。而且自负得一笔,对开发者的需求视而不见,以为自己的影响力足以掌控一切

風美由飛 发表于 2014-11-13 12:20

.net做个全平台的framework安装包就OK了呀。.net本来就有第三方在小打小闹的,微软上阵力道更足。拳打php,脚踢java,碾压oracledb做做梦就可以了。
    —— from S1 Nyan (NOKIA Lumia 526)

鸡蛋灌饼 发表于 2014-11-13 12:20

nonmoi 发表于 2014-11-13 12:12
虽然的确是这样,但是.net有多语言支持等特性,如果当年就能泛平台,竞争力应该还是有的。
当时不泛平台 ...

多语言支持看上去高大上,但学过编译器的都知道这不过是你愿意写几个前端的问题……

iou90 发表于 2014-11-13 12:36

@vdo .net native
    —— from S1 Nyan

nonmoi 发表于 2014-11-13 12:39

jun4rui 发表于 2014-11-13 12:05
1、.net 要开源,支持mac和linux
目前这个来说,其实还很初级,你看,现在其实也就开放了部分源代码,要真 ...

2你搞错了,社区版是5人以下的开发公司免费——即使是用来开发商业软件。

trentswd 发表于 2014-11-13 12:40

vs刷版本号太难受了
vs不像office,vs装了要卸载干净是很难的,官方的回答是是如果你想恢复到未装vs的环境最简单的办法就是重装系统
升级一次要我一次命

----发送自 OnePlus A0001,Android 4.4.4

nonmoi 发表于 2014-11-13 12:40

本帖最后由 nonmoi 于 2014-11-13 12:43 编辑

鸡蛋灌饼 发表于 2014-11-13 12:20
多语言支持看上去高大上,但学过编译器的都知道这不过是你愿意写几个前端的问题…… ...
对于开发团队/企业来说,不需要另外学习、培训,或者招募会一门新语言的工程师就可获得泛平台开发能力——我说的吸引力是这个方面的。

这一切的前提都是在.net发布之初的那个时段,现在来说,即使多开源,多牛逼,在短时间内也难以对Java造成什么影响了。

jun4rui 发表于 2014-11-13 12:42

wangh 发表于 2014-11-13 12:48

trentswd 发表于 2014-11-13 12:40
vs刷版本号太难受了
vs不像office,vs装了要卸载干净是很难的,官方的回答是是如果你想恢复到未装vs的环境 ...

升级关卸载什么事,不同vs版本是平行安装的又不需要卸载老的

iou90 发表于 2014-11-13 12:58

trentswd 发表于 2014-11-13 12:40
vs刷版本号太难受了
vs不像office,vs装了要卸载干净是很难的,官方的回答是是如果你想恢复到未装vs的环境 ...

从2012开始卸载好了点 之前重新装一遍确实要老命

風美由飛 发表于 2014-11-13 13:20

vs平行安装不会出人命吗?最多一个wp8sdk(vs2012)和任一一个其它vs混搭我觉得是极限了。
    —— from S1 Nyan (NOKIA Lumia 526)

HyperIris 发表于 2014-11-13 13:25

allenz 发表于 2014-11-13 13:36

引用第27楼nonmoi于2014-11-13 12:39发表的:
引用:jun4rui 发表于 2014-11-13 12:051、.net 要开源,支持mac和li......

@nonmoi
限制比这个宽,100w资本(貌似是)以下的公司最多使用5份授权,教育科研等用途无限制

----发送自 Sony C6833,Android 4.4.2

nonmoi 发表于 2014-11-13 14:28

allenz 发表于 2014-11-13 13:36
@nonmoi
限制比这个宽,100w资本(貌似是)以下的公司最多使用5份授权,教育科研等用途无限制



是这样啊,我也没详细看,听人转述的,回头具体研究一下好了。

trentswd 发表于 2014-11-13 14:35

平行安装我遇到过windows SDK的问题,最后改注册表解决
平时的小问题是我开一个DMP文件会蹦出一个我预料不到的版本
最主要的问题是我装那么多干啥……

----发送自 OnePlus A0001,Android 4.4.4

heerorelena 发表于 2014-11-13 14:46

说到授权,基本上靠自觉。

——— 来自Stage1st Reader For iOS

風美由飛 发表于 2014-11-13 15:30

oh,shi,update4都出了,大小一如既往的另人望而生畏,还不如直接换社区版呢。
页: [1] 2
查看完整版本: 【s1都是开发者】巨硬这几步算正道还是邪道?